Canopy Pruning in San Jose, CA
Canopy pruning services involve carefully trimming and shaping the upper branches of trees to promote healthy growth, improve safety, and enhance the overall appearance of a property. This type of pruning typically focuses on the upper sections of trees, removing dead, damaged, or overgrown limbs, and ensuring that the canopy remains balanced and well-maintained. Projects may include thinning dense branches to increase light penetration, reducing weight to prevent storm damage, or shaping trees to complement landscape design. Property owners often request canopy pruning to maintain the health of their trees, prevent potential hazards from falling branches, and improve visibility and aesthetics around their homes.
Before requesting canopy pruning, property owners usually want to understand the scope of work, including which branches will be removed and how the process might affect the tree’s health and appearance. It’s also helpful to consider the timing of the pruning, as certain seasons are better suited for specific types of cuts to support growth and recovery. Clarifying the goals-such as safety, aesthetic improvement, or health-can ensure the project meets expectations. Proper planning and understanding of the process can lead to better outcomes for the trees and the overall property landscape.

Common Canopy Pruning Jobs
Canopy pruning - involves trimming the upper branches to improve tree structure and health.
Fruit tree canopy trimming - enhances sunlight exposure and fruit production for fruit-bearing trees.
Safety pruning - removes dead or hazardous branches to prevent potential damage or injury.
Shaping and aesthetic pruning - maintains the desired tree form and enhances curb appeal.
Growth regulation - controls canopy density to promote healthy development and airflow.
Storm damage pruning - clears broken or compromised branches after severe weather events.
Canopy Pruning Questions
What is canopy pruning? Canopy pruning involves selectively trimming the upper branches of a tree to improve its structure and health.
Why should property owners consider canopy pruning? It helps maintain the tree’s shape, reduces risk of falling branches, and promotes better growth.
What types of trees benefit from canopy pruning? Most mature trees, especially those with dense or overgrown canopies, can benefit from this service.
When is the best time for canopy pruning? The ideal time is during the tree’s dormant season or when it is least active to minimize stress and promote recovery.
